Bittensor (TAO) at $226.10: The Decentralized AI Network – Quietly Building

The Numbers Right Now:
Price: $226.1024h Change: +7.21%ATH: $767.68 (March 2024)4h High: $227.304h Low: $218.6024h Volume: $298.51MMarket Cap: $2.50BVWAP (Session): $221.70EMA (8): $215.70
What Is Bittensor?
Bittensor is building a decentralized machine learning network — a global, open marketplace where computers contribute computing power to train AI models and earn TAO tokens in return.
Think of it as a distributed neural network. Instead of one company controlling the training of AI models, Bittensor distributes it across a global network of participants.
The more valuable a machine's contribution, the more TAO it earns. It's a bold vision: AI that is owned by everyone, not just big tech.
At its peak in March 2024, TAO hit $767.68. Now it sits at $226.10.
What's Happening in 2026?
The network has been growing steadily, even as the price has pulled back from its highs.
Key network updates:
Inference pricing — Bittensor has the ability to monetize compute and data usageOpen-source contributions — all code is publicly available, a key requirement for decentralized AI developmentCommunity-driven development — many open-source projects are building on Bittensor

Demystifying Node Tokenomics: How Distributed Consensus Powers the $OPEN Ecosystem

The monetization of artificial intelligence relies on a foundational pipeline that is under constant legal scrutiny: high-quality training data. Massive Web2 companies routinely face complex copyright lawsuits for unauthorized scraping of digital footprints across the web. This model creates severe operational vulnerabilities for developers seeking to build trustworthy applications. @OpenLedger offers an elegant architectural resolution to this crisis with $OPEN introducing a decentralized, secure layout that shifts the paradigm under #OpenLedger from covert data collection to localized, permissioned on-chain data distribution.
🖥️ The Operational Role of Distributed Data Nodes
Within a traditional machine learning environment, data collection, clearing, and structural formatting happen behind closed corporate server doors. This architecture leads to a lack of transparency and introduces significant vectors for data manipulation. The protocol resolves this bottleneck by utilizing distributed node networks.
These validator nodes act as decentralized filters. When a large data block is submitted to the ecosystem, the nodes execute automated cryptographic verification protocols to prove its authenticity, compliance, and ultimate utility score. By processing these data assets on a decentralized, EVM-compatible Layer 2, the infrastructure removes central failure points and prevents data corruption before the information ever reaches active AI training models.
📈 Staking Dynamics and Economic Velocity
The internal economic loop driving this machine learning marketplace is governed entirely by the native token utility. Staking serves multiple structural functions across the layer:
Collateralized Security: Node operators lock up assets as economic collateral. This ensures a high level of accountability, as malicious or inaccurate data validation results in automated slashing penalties.Yield Allocation: Participants who dedicate storage capacity or processing power to the network receive direct distributions funded via network gas usage and developer query fees.Democratized Access: Retail token holders who do not possess advanced server hardware can delegate their holding weight to established validator pools, enjoying partial yield rewards without complex technical upkeep.
As the broader decentralized physical infrastructure sector continues to mature, protocols that successfully combine crowd-sourced hardware with machine learning infrastructure are positioned for sustained network velocity.

The AI Blockchain Evolution: Why @OpenLedger is Rewriting the Rules of the Data Economy

The intersection of Artificial Intelligence (AI) and Decentralized Physical Infrastructure Networks (DePIN) is arguably the most explosive narrative in Web3 today. While traditional AI development remains heavily gatekept by centralized tech monopolies, a paradigm shift is happening on-chain. Leading this charge is @OpenLedger, the world's first AI-native blockchain designed specifically to democratize, secure, and monetize the entire AI lifecycle.
Solving the Centralized AI Crisis
Right now, general-purpose LLMs face massive hurdles: data manipulation risks, a lack of transparency in training models, and zero rewards for the communities that actually create the data. @OpenLedger changes the game by introducing an EVM-compatible Layer 2 framework that makes data, models, and AI agents fully liquid, traceable, and composable.
At the heart of this ecosystem are three key innovations:
Datanets: Community-owned, on-chain data hubs focused on specific domains (e.g., legal, medical, or niche tech datasets) that allow users to securely contribute high-quality data.
Proof of Attribution (PoA): This groundbreaking protocol tracks exactly how much a specific piece of data influences an AI model's output, ensuring completely transparent data provenance.
ModelFactory & OpenLoRA: A zero-code infrastructure layer allowing developers to fine-tune specialized language models (SLMs) efficiently without needing massive, expensive server farms.
Real Utility Behind the $OPEN Token
Unlike many speculative tokens riding the AI wave, the native token $OPEN serves as the literal lifeblood of the network. It handles network gas fees, powers the deployment of custom models, and facilitates real-time, fair rewards for data contributors and node operators.
By tying token utility directly to compute power and dataset curation, OpenLedger is shifting the narrative from "hype" to sustainable infrastructure.
